This document supersedes EN 2889:1995. EN 2889:20064 1 Scope This standard specifies the characteris

20、tics of bolts, normal hexagonal head, coarse tolerance normal shank, short thread, in alloy steel, cadmium plated. Classification: 900 MPa1)/ 235 C2). 2 Normative references The following referenced documents are indispensable for the application of this document. For dated references, only the edit

21、ion cited applies. For undated references, the latest edition of the referenced document (including any amendments) applies. ISO 3193, Aerospace Bolts, normal hexagonal head, normal shank, short or medium length MJ threads, metallic material, coated or uncoated, strength classes less than or equal t

22、o 1 100 MPa Dimensions ISO 3353-1, Aerospace Lead and runout threads Part 1: Rolled external threads ISO 5855-2, Aerospace MJ threads Part 2: Limit dimensions for bolts and nuts ISO 7689, Aerospace Bolts, with MJ threads, made with alloy steel, strength class 1 100 MPa Procurement specification ISO

23、7913, Aerospace Bolts and screws, metric Tolerances of form and position EN 2133, Aerospace series Cadmium plating of steels with maximum specified tensile strength 1 450 MPa, copper, copper alloys and nickel alloys EN 2424, Aerospace series Marking of aerospace products EN 9100, Aerospace series -

24、Quality management systems - Requirements (based on ISO 9001:2000) and Quality systems - Model for quality assurance in design, development, production, installation and servicing (based on ISO 9001:1994) TR 3775, Aerospace series Bolts and pins National materials3)1) Minimum tensile strength of the

25、 material at ambient temperature. 2) Maximum temperature that the bolt can withstand without continuous change in its original characteristics, after return to ambient temperature. The maximum temperature is determined by the surface treatment. 3) Published as ASD Technical Report at the date of pub

26、lication of this standard. EN 2889:20065 3 Required characteristics 3.1 Configuration Dimensions Masses See Figure 1 and Table 1. Dimensions and tolerances are: in conformity with ISO 3193, expressed in millimetres and apply after surface treatment. Details of form not stated are left to the manufac

27、turers discretion. 3.2 Tolerances of form and position See ISO 7913. 3.3 Materials TR 3775 (alloy steel, strength class 900 MPa). 3.4 Surface treatment EN 2133, 8 m to 14 m, on all surfaces which can be contacted by a 20 mm diameter ball. On all other surfaces, a continuous cadmium plating shall be

28、present, but no value is specified. Black colour option: code B (EN 2133, except for corrosion resistance requirement). They apply to bolts without holes. fValue for head and first L4gIncrease for each additional millimetre of L4. EN 2889:20069 4 Designation EXAMPLE Description block Identity block BOLT EN2889

36、 D 080 060 B Number of this standard Hole code (see Table 2) Diameter code (see Table 1) Length code (see Table 1) Black colour code (see 3.4) NOTE If necessary, the code I9005 shall be placed between the description block and the identity block. Table 2 Holes Code Lockwire H Split pin D Lockwire an

37、d split pin C No hole (hyphen) 5 Marking See Table 3 and Figure 1, indented. Table 3 Diameter code EN 2424 Style 030 and 040 N 050 to 200 C + MJ 6 Technical specification ISO 7689, with the following modifications: 6.1 Approval of manufacturers See EN 9100. 6.2 Other modified requirements Hardness a

38、t the end of the thread, apply: in Brinell: 269/321 HBS in Vickers: 284/340 HV 30 Classification of defects: replace AQL 0,065 % by 1 %. 6.3 Requirement deleted Qualification of bolts; Cold rolling; Tension fatigue strength; Tensile strength; Head to shank fillet work effect.
